Entry Requirements

A pass with a minimum CGPA of 2.75 or equivalent, as accepted by the University Senate; or equivalent with minimum CGPA of 2.50 and not meeting CGPA of 2.75, can be accepted subject to a minimum of 2 years working experience in relevant field; or equivalent not meeting CGPA of 2.50, can be accepted subject to a minimum of 5 years working experience in relevant field.

A minimum score of Band 6.0 in the International English Language Testing System (IELTS); or  minimum score of 550 for a paper-based total or 80 for an Internet based total for the Test of English as a Foreign Language (TOEFL); or minimum of Grade C in First Cambridge English (FCE) minimum scale 169, or B2 in CEFR, or Pearson Test of English (PTE 50-58) as required proficiency; or a recognized first degree undertaken in English medium; or successful attainment of FCE minimum of Grade C (169) conducted by the Centre for English Language (CEL) within 12 months from the date of entry with conditional offer letter.

Note: The validity period for IELTS and TOEFL is two years from the date awarded.
